Crack on runway leads to emergency closure at Kona airport

The state Department of Transportation briefly suspended air operations at Ellison Onizuka Kona International Airport at Keahole at 1:35 p.m. today “to address a crack discovered on the runway.”

Crews patched the crack, and the runway reopened at about 3 p.m.

DOT said crews will do a “permanent repair” from 11:30 p.m. tonight to 5 a.m. Friday.

Approximately six flights were inbound to the Kona airport at the time the crack was discovered, according to DOT.

Three flights were diverted to Kahului Airport on Maui and will be rerouted.
